Output 4585012377fda16d55c85e82262bedfc726e37b74b3919ab2c4db3ec35df6793:18

value
156383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42c3704867bc8e3b749661cb2d4304d6519ecb66 OP_EQUAL
address
37n2eWw4DJQTR2Mnt6vGtdWeWkDTBDmTy5
transaction
4585012377fda16d55c85e82262bedfc726e37b74b3919ab2c4db3ec35df6793
confirmations
129712
spent
true